October 29, if you haven’t marked it up in your calendar, is the International Internet Day, which has been famously celebrated since 2005. There haven’t been too many celebrations since it was first established, but that doesn’t mean that there’s any reason to disregard the event.

 

Back in 1969, on October 29, the very first electronic message was sent from a computer in the science department at UCLA to another computer at the Stanford Research Institute. The transmission wasn’t an extremely complicated one, but simply told the recipient to login to SRI. Well, out of the “login” word, only the first two letters were actually sent before the system crashed. The full login took place without a hitch about an hour later.
